Centaurus A

This is a photo of Centaurus A I took two weekends ago when we were having some clearer weather.

There are 202 light frames at 30 seconds and ISO 1600. 27 dark frames. It was taken through a 8 inch Newtonian on an AZ-EQ6 mount. Hope you all like!
